Park So-dam, born on September eighth, nineteen ninety-one, is a talented South Korean actress known for her versatile performances across film and stage. She first garnered attention with her roles in the film The Priests in two thousand fifteen and the television series Cinderella with Four Knights in two thousand sixteen. Her ability to captivate audiences has made her a prominent figure in the South Korean entertainment industry.

In two thousand twenty, Park starred in the acclaimed series Record of Youth, further solidifying her status as a leading actress. Her recent work includes the highly anticipated series Death's Game, which is set to air from two thousand twenty-three to two thousand twenty-four. Each of these projects showcases her range and dedication to her craft.

However, it was her role in the dark comedy thriller film Parasite, released in two thousand nineteen, that catapulted her to international fame. The film received critical acclaim, winning the prestigious Palme d'Or at the Cannes Film Festival and the Academy Award for Best Picture. Park and her fellow cast members were honored with the Award for Outstanding Performance by a Cast in a Motion Picture at the twenty-sixth Screen Actors Guild Awards, marking a significant milestone in her career.
